Fried chicken

(for 2 people)

2 chicken breasts

2 dl potato chips

1/2 dl grated parmesan

1 egg

1/2 dl spelled wheat flour

1/2 tsp finger salt

a few grinds of black pepper from the grinder

cooking oil for frying

In addition:

1 tbsp (about 150 g) salad mix

2 blood oranges

balsamic vinegar

olive oil

finger salt

a few grinds of black pepper from the grinder

1. Pound the chicken breast fillets a little thinner. Crush the chips with your hands into a coarse crumb and mix in the grated parmesan. Crack an egg into another bowl. In the third bowl, mix finger salt and black pepper into the wheat flour.

2. Roll the chicken fillets first in wheat flour, then in egg and finally in the potato chip-Parmesan mixture. Fry in plenty of oil until golden brown and crispy.

3. Serve breaded chicken fillets on a bed of salad. Segment the blood oranges and sprinkle balsamic vinegar and olive oil on top, season with finger salt and black pepper. Slice the chicken fillets and place on top of the salad.
